"""
usage: mpdsigjob  sigtype  [-j jobid OR -a jobalias] [-s|g]
    sigtype must be the first arg
    jobid can be obtained via mpdlistjobs and is of the form:
        jobnum@mpdid where mpdid is mpd where first process runs, e.g.:
            1@linux02_32996 (may need \@ in some shells)
            1  is sufficient if you are on the machine where the job started
    one of -j or -a must be specified (but only one)
    -s or -g specify whether to signal the single user process or its group (default is g)
Delivers a Unix signal to all the application processes in the job
"""
